计算机视觉用到的技术知识(计算机视觉用到的技术知识有哪些)

计算机视觉5个月前更新 123how
0 0 0

摘要:计算机视觉是指通过计算机技术对图像或视频进行智能处理和分析的学科领域。它涉及到许多前沿技术,如图像处理机器学习深度学习等。本文将从图像获取、特征提取、目标检测和场景理解这四个方面,详细介绍计算机视觉所用到的技术知识。

计算机视觉用到的技术知识(计算机视觉用到的技术知识有哪些)插图

一、图像获取

图像获取是计算机视觉应用中的第一步。它是指通过摄像头、扫描仪或其他设备,将现实世界中的视觉信息转换成数字信号,以供计算机处理和分析。在图像获取的过程中,涉及到很多技术,如图像压缩、曝光控制、自动对焦等。

其中,图像压缩是一种常见的技术,它可以将图像数据压缩到更小的空间中,减小数据的存储和传输成本。图像压缩主要包括有损压缩和无损压缩两种方式。有损压缩可以达到更高的压缩比,但会损失一定的图像质量。而无损压缩则可以保持图像数据的完整性,计算机视觉但压缩比相对较低。

此外,现代图像获取设备还可以通过自动对焦和曝光控制等技术,自动调整图像的清晰度和亮度,并减少噪声等干扰因素的影响。这些技术的应用,极大地提高了计算机视觉应用的可靠性和效率。

二、特征提取

特征提取是计算机视觉应用中的核心技术之一。它是指从数字图像或视频中,抽取出代表其本质特征的信息,以进行进一步处理和分析。常用的特征提取算法包括边缘检测、角点检测、直线检测、颜色分割等。

边缘检测算法可以识别图像中的物体轮廓和边缘,是图像分割和形状分析的基础。

角点检测算法可以识别图像中的角点位置和数量,是图像匹配和跟踪的重要支持。

直线检测算法可以检测图像中的直线段,是图像几何分析和建模的关键算法之一。

颜色分割算法可以将图像中的像素根据颜色值进行分类,是图像识别和分类的重要技术之一。

特征提取的好坏,直接影响了后续的目标检测和场景理解等计算机视觉应用的精度和可靠性。

三、目标检测

目标检测是计算机视觉应用中的重要环节之一。它是指从数字图像或视频中,识别和定位感兴趣的目标物体,如人脸、车辆等,并进行分类和标记。常用的目标检测算法包括Haar级联分类器、HOG特征+SVM分类器、卷积神经网络等。

Haar级联分类器是一种基于弱分类器级联的目标检测算法。它通过对图像的多个子区域进行快速分类,实现对目目标检测标物体的高效准确检测。

HOG特征+SVM分类器是一种基于图像局部梯度方向特征和支持向量机分类器的目标检测算法。它在人脸检测、行人检测等任务中表现出色。

卷积神经网络是一种深度学习算法,它能够从原始数据中自动学习到高层次的特征表示,广泛应用于图像分类、目标检测等领域。

目标检测技术的快速发展,为人们提供了更加高效、精确的计算机视觉应用,是计算机视觉领域的一个热门研究方向。

四、场景理解

场景理图像解是计算机视觉应用的最终目标,它是指对数字图像或视频进行全方位的理解和描述,包括物体识别、场景分类、3D重建等多个方面。

其中,物体识别是识别图像中所有分离物体并标注其类别、位置和大小等信息的过程。它是计算机视觉应用中的重要环节,可以广泛应用于智能监控、自动驾驶等领域。

场景分类是指将图像中的场景划分成不同的类别,如室内场景、室外场景、自然场景等。它是一种基础性的技术,可以为计算机视觉应用提供更加丰富的语义信息。

3D重建是将多幅图像或视频中的场景物体进行三维建模,重建出其准确的三维位置、大小和形状等信息。它在虚拟现实、机器人导航等领域发挥着重要的作用。

场景理解是计算机视觉领域的最终目标,它的实现,需要对图像和视频数据进行全方位、多维度的分析和处理。

五、总结

本文从图像获取、特征提取、目标检测和场景理解四个方面,详细介绍了计算机视觉应用中所用到的技术知识。

随着人工智能的广泛应用和发展,计算机视觉技术也在不断演进和升级。未来,我们可以期待更加高效、精确、智能的计算机视觉应用的出现。

© 版权声明

相关文章